Woven sausages

Spread the love

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 400 g flour
  • 170 ml milk
  • 8 g yeast
  • 40 g lard
  • 7 g salt
  • 14 sausages (the quantity depends on the size of the sausages)
  • some butter
  • some sesame

Instructions

Working time approx. 30 minutes; Rest time approx. 2 hours; Cooking/baking time approx. 30 minutes; Total time approx. 3 hours

Put the flour in a bowl and make a well in the center. Dissolve the yeast in lukewarm milk and pour it into the well, then mix with a little flour. Add the softened lard and salt and work everything into a smooth dough with your hands. Cover and let rest in a warm place for 2 hours. Roll out the dough on a floured work surface into a rectangle measuring 20 x 30 cm. Place the dough sheet on a baking tray lined with baking paper. Leave a border of about 3 cm all around and cut the rest into strips of about 3 cm wide. Now thread the sausages alternately into the strips of dough, like weaving. Brush the dough with melted butter and sprinkle with sesame seeds. Bake in an oven preheated to 180 °C until golden brown, about 30 minutes. Remove from the oven and serve.
